Good News for Aspiring Entrepreneurs!

KOSGEB applicants who wanted to receive the 50,000 TL grant used to be required to obtain a certificate proving they had successfully completed 70 hours of practical entrepreneurship training, including 24 hours of workshop sessions. Only after receiving that certificate could entrepreneurs apply for the grant. This requirement created delays and difficulties for many applicants. Furthermore, previously KOSGEB support was provided only after related business expenses were incurred.

As of February 1, KOSGEB introduced a new regulation removing the requirement to have the certificate before opening a business. Under the new rule, individuals who plan to start their own business can apply to KOSGEB first; if their business idea is approved, they can receive funding immediately.

What Are the Eligibility Requirements for the 50,000 TL Grant?

There are two main conditions for applicants seeking the grant to start their own business: they must not be employed with social security (SGK) at another workplace, and they must not already own a company.

How Will Applications Be Made Under the New System?

With the changes introduced by the new system, the application steps are as follows:

  1. Before registering a company, apply to KOSGEB and have your business idea evaluated and approved by the committee.
  2. After approval, you must register your company related to the approved business idea within 90 days at the latest.
  3. Because you apply to KOSGEB before company registration, you will not have a tax number yet. To document expected costs, you can submit proforma invoices to the committee.

How Do KOSGEB Committees Evaluate Applications?

The committees review applications submitted by entrepreneurs who apply before establishing their business. They assess the planned enterprises for sustainability, profitability, and sectoral potential. Passing this committee review depends on how well applicants present and justify their business idea.

How Much Support Can You Receive?

KOSGEB provides up to 50,000 TL in grants for applicants who cannot otherwise finance opening a business and, in addition, offers interest-free loans up to 100,000 TL. If your idea is approved, you may receive up to 150,000 TL in total support. Applicants are notified of the committee’s decision, whether positive or negative.

How Many Times Can You Apply?

Approved applicants must establish their business, register in the KOSGEB database, and sign a declaration within 90 days. Candidates who fail to complete these steps within the specified period forfeit their application right. Each candidate may apply up to three times. Applicants who receive a negative decision three times in a row lose their right to apply for this support.

Is the Support Available in All Provinces?

KOSGEB operates across all 81 provinces and has branches, directorates, and representatives in various districts.
